Case 4339 APPLICATION OF GLUCANASE TO CONTROL INDUSTRIAL SLIME Abstract of the Disclosure A method of attacking and removing microbial slime in slime covered surfaces and maintaining a slime-free surface as in exposed cooling tower surfaces and in waste water treatment and paper making. This method comprises utilizing an enzyme blend in 2 to 100 parts per million (ppm) of beta-glucanase, alpha- amylase and protease. Glucanase has been found specifically to digest microbial slime and reduce microbial attachment and biofilm. A specific combination of polysaccharide degrading enzymes is a ratio of 2 parts beta-glucanase to 1 alpha-amylase to 1 protease utilized in 2-100 parts per million. Broadly, the alpha-amylase must be at least 1 and the protease may vary from .5 to 1 part.
